- Inner - definition of inner by The Free Dictionary
1 situated within or farther within; interior: an inner room 2 more intimate, private, or secret: the inner workings of an organization 3 of or pertaining to the mind or spirit; mental; spiritual: the inner life 4 not obvious; hidden or obscure: an inner meaning
